摘 要:
通过比较采摘期(6-10月)鄂尔多斯地区俄罗斯大果沙棘和中国沙棘雌雄株鲜叶主要生化成分含量表明,7月俄罗斯大果沙棘雄株鲜叶总黄酮含量为1.72%、粗多糖含量为3.62%、咖啡碱含量为0.68%、总多酚含量15.7%,为最佳沙棘叶茶原料.以7月中旬俄罗斯大果沙棘雄株鲜叶为原料,进一步比较了热风杀青、微波杀青和烘青3种杀青工艺对沙棘叶茶品质的影响,并优化最佳工艺.主要生化成分分析与感官审评表明,热风杀青为沙棘叶茶最佳杀青工艺,工艺参数为:杀青时长120 s、杀青温度180℃、投叶量1.5 kg.

摘 要:
During the leaf picking period from June to October,the contents of main biochemical components of the male and female leaves of Russian and Chinese seabuckthorn tea trees in the Ordos region were compared. The results indicated that in July,seabuckthorn leaves from Russian giant fruit male plants were the best raw materials,containing a total of 1. 72% flavonoids,3. 62%crude polysaccharides,0.68% caffeine,and 15.7% polyphenols. The effects of three different fixing technologies,namely,hot air fixing,microwave fixing,and bake fixing technology,on the quality of seabuckthorn leaf tea were compared using the fresh leaves of Russian big fruit seabuckthorn picked in mid-July to find the best optimized fixing technology. The main biochemical components analysis and sensory evaluation of the measurement showed that the hot air fixing process was the best fixing technology for processing seabuckthorn leaf tea with technological parameters of 120 sec length,180 ℃,and 1.5 kg leaf weight.
